Job Description
The Safety and Security Officer is responsible for providing
protection and communication with hotel guest and associates.
He/she is also responsible for patrolling the entire resort in
company issued vehicles to maintain security, detect and report
fire, security and safety hazards and/or violations of company
rules and regulations.
Qualification Standards
Education & Experience:
- High School diploma or equivalent and/or experience in a hotel
or related field preferred.
- Must provide valid proof of automobile insurance and pass a
Motor Vehicle Record (MVR).
- Any position required to drive company vehicles will be
subjected to pre employment and random drug testing.
- MUST have a Security License and at least 2 years of experience
in the field Physical requirements:
- Flexible and long hours sometimes required.
- Heavy work - Exerting up to 100 pounds of force occasionally,
and/or 50 pounds of force frequently or constantly to lift, carry,
push, pull or otherwise move objects.
- Must be able to climb stairs, descent stairs and run.
- On occasion, must physically deter individuals who pose a
threat to guests and/or associates.
- Ability to stand during entire shift. Mental Requirements:

Essential:
- Approach all encounters with guests and associates in an
attentive, friendly, courteous and service-oriented manner.
- Maintain regular attendance in compliance with standards, as
required by scheduling which will vary according to the needs of
the hotel.
- Maintain high standards of personal appearance and grooming,
which include wearing the proper uniform and name tag when
working.
- Comply at all times with standards and regulations to encourage
safe and efficient hotel operations.
- Maintain a warm and friendly demeanor at all times.
- Associates must at all times be attentive, friendly, helpful
and courteous to all guests, managers and fellow associates.
- Ensure implementation and compliance of Fertitta Hospitality's
Code of Conduct.
- Use proper two-radio etiquette at all times.
- Maintain visual contact with the Front Desk/Night Audit Auditor
and the front door of the hotel by remaining in the lobby area when
not on property walks.
- Maintain and review daily activity log.
- Maintain confidentiality with respect to guest and employee
incidents.
- Hold briefing with Guest Services staff both at the beginning
and end of shift.
- Check ID of visitors/associates as necessary.
- Access secured areas for authorized personnel.
- Maintain an awareness of legal limitation of position (local,
state and/or federal ordinances).
- Assist guests to their rooms or assist guest's w/entry into
their rooms according to hotel standards.
- Assist during medical emergencies.
- Respond to emergency situation, including medical, security,
guest complaints, etc.
- Investigate assault complaints.
- Assist outside agencies, as necessary, to maintain effective
liaison.
- Respond to altercations, and investigate.
- Have knowledge of hotel and guestroom locking system.
- Monitor TV cameras.
- Administer First Aid/CPR as necessary.
- Challenge suspicious persons.
- Check safety hazards.
- Administer Heimlich Maneuver to choking victims.
- Complete Incident/Accident reports in a clear and concise
manner.
- Monitor employees as they enter and exit the building.
- Conduct investigations relative to property losses, guest and
employee accidents, and illnesses and crimes against the
hotel.
- Patrol area to insure that areas are secure and free of
unauthorized persons and disturbances.
- Provide escorts to persons carrying money, or other
requests.
- Issue and inventory pagers, radio equipment and keys on a daily
basis.
